Written Answers — Department of Transport, Tourism and Sport: Memoranda of Understanding (9 Jun 2020)

Shane Ross: At the outset, I wish to point out that this is a commercial operational matter for the Port of Cork Company. I understand from the Port of Cork Company that they signed a Memorandum of Understanding with NextDecade in 2017 to attract new LNG business into Ireland from the USA. Written Answers — Department of Transport, Tourism and Sport: Departmental Projects (9 Jun 2020)

Shane Ross: The Connecting Europe Facility (CEF) is the EU's funding instrument for the Trans-European Transport Network (TEN-T). Funding under CEF is delivered in the form of grants awarded following competitive calls for proposals.
